Targeted internal communications based on information consumption?

As far as I am aware internal communicators serve information to staff based on the need, age, tenure, career levels, organization’s priorities and focus areas, importance and maturity of the individual within the organization, time of the day among other reasons. Planning, Managing and Communicating a Successful Leadership Team Meeting

Internal communicators may be involved directly or indirectly in organizing and communicating internal leadership forums that connect and energize  the community.
